Vertebral augmentation, typically involving procedures such as vertebroplasty and kyphoplasty, addresses the structural integrity of the vertebrae that may have been compromised due to osteoporosis, trauma, or tumors. By utilizing a vertebral augmentation device, medical professionals can restore stability to the spine, allowing patients to reclaim their mobility and independence.

Chronic back pain can be debilitating, limiting a person's ability to engage in daily activities or enjoy life. The primary role of vertebral augmentation devices is to alleviate this pain by stabilizing the affected vertebrae. The procedure involves injecting a special bone cement into the fractured vertebra, which solidifies and provides immediate support. This significant pain relief often translates into an improved ability to perform routine tasks, social engagements, and participate in physical activities.

Moreover, restoring the vertebral structure helps prevent further deformity and complications associated with untreated fractures. Before the advent of vertebral augmentation devices, many patients faced prolonged periods of limited mobility and severe discomfort, which could lead to further health complications, such as muscle atrophy and depression. By contrast, those who undergo vertebral augmentation can often return to a more active lifestyle, which has a profound impact on their mental well-being and social interactions.

One of the most notable aspects of vertebral augmentation procedures is their minimally invasive nature. Traditional surgical options often involved extended recovery times and significant risks. However, the use of vertebral augmentation devices generally results in outpatient procedures with faster recovery periods, allowing patients to return home the same day and reduce overall healthcare costs.

The benefits extend beyond physical health as well. As patients experience reduced pain, the psychological repercussions of living with chronic discomfort—such as anxiety and depression—commonly diminish. Many individuals report increased levels of satisfaction in their personal and professional lives following treatment. Increased interaction with family, friends, and hobbies can foster a supportive environment, which is essential for holistic recovery.
